Abstract
The utility model discloses a kind of machine shop floor cleaning equipment, including chassis, dust catcher, water tank and cleaning handle, the two sides of the bottom on the chassis are symmetrically arranged with directional wheel, the tray bottom short side center position is connected with universal wheel, the chassis corresponds to universal wheel corresponding position and is connected with push bracket, the bottom side on the chassis is slidably connected by symmetrically arranged cleaning water tank sliding rail and cleaning water tank, and link block is symmetrically arranged on the upper surface of the side of cleaning water tank, the cleaning water tank side vertical with water tank sliding rail moving direction is cleaned is connect by the 2nd MYT3-23 hydraulic driver with chassis.In the utility model, electromagnet is installed in the inside of suction inlet, in this way when dust catcher clears up floor-dust, the iron filings of quality weight can be adsorbed under the sucking action of electromagnet by electromagnet, effectively solve the problems, such as that mill floor iron filings difficulty is cleared up, structure is simple, and cleaning effect is obvious.
